I look forward to writing articles about my favorite band, Jethro Tull! I have been a fan since fourteen and am now a bigger fan than ever. I remember being struck by Aqualung and Locomotive Breath on the radio. I knew this band was truly different. I loved the sound of the music. My eighth grade science teacher was a big fan and from that faithful generation that Tull had emerged out of. As did many other legendary rock groups. But none like Tull. I became an avid fan after hearing Original Masters, which was a a best of compilation, including classics such as Aqualung, Too old to rock and roll, Bungle in the jungle, Sweet Dream, Songs form the wood and more. It wasn't until I got the Aqualung album that I became a real fan. Then I worked my way up from there, from Thick As a Brick, Stand Up, Benefit and others.

I was lucky enough to attend a Tull concert last year, that was a life changing experience for a fan such as myself. And I hope to see them again, this summer in Boston.
